Когда я впервые стал изучать программирование‚ одним из необходимых навыков было понимание значения переменных после выполнения кода․ В частности‚ я был заинтересован в том‚ какое значение может иметь переменная $var после выполнения определенного кода․Однажды‚ я решил провести эксперимент‚ чтобы проверить‚ какое значение будет присвоено переменной $var после выполнения кода․ Я создал простую программу на PHP‚ в которой было несколько строк кода․ Вот как выглядела программа⁚
php
php
$var 5;
if ($var > 3) {
$var $var 2;
}
else {
$var $var ─ 1;
}
echo $var;
?>
В этом коде я определил переменную $var и присвоил ей значение 5․ Затем я использовал условное выражение if-else для проверки значения переменной․ Если $var была больше 3‚ то ей присваивалось новое значение‚ равное ее текущему значению плюс 2․ В противном случае‚ $var уменьшалась на 1․ В конце программы я вывел значение переменной на экран с помощью функции echo․
Теперь‚ когда я запустил программу‚ я был любопытен‚ какое значение будет присвоено переменной $var после выполнения кода․ Что ж‚ результат оказался неожиданным․ После выполнения программы на экране появилось число 7․
Я был удивлен‚ так как ожидал‚ что переменная $var будет иметь значение 7․ Такое значение получается из-за того‚ что 5 больше 3 и выполняется блок кода внутри условного выражения if․ В этом блоке мы увеличиваем значение переменной на 2‚ что приводит к значению 7․
Таким образом‚ в результате выполнения данного кода‚ значение переменной $var будет равно 7․ Этот эксперимент наглядно показал мне‚ как важно понимать и проверять значения переменных в программе‚ чтобы быть уверенным в правильности ее работы․